@Lowe,There really is no rules foe a preop diet or even if you need one at all. It can't hurt and is generally beneficial for you as it may reduce the size of your liver making surgery easier, keeps your bowels from being packed full post-op when going may be difficult and gives you a jump start on losing.

What is the diet that everyone is talking about? My surgery is 7-25 and no one said anything yet to me. Maybe i should start to get a jump start.

Simply put, NO SOLIDS just liquids. Protein shakes, juice and Water. SF Jello is OK too. If your doc or nut didn't tell you to please call and make sure it's OK, while I can't think of a reason it wouldn't be just be sure it's OK first.

Almost everyone can stay on this diet for 2 or 3 weeks, especially when we know ht operation is coming up. It's trying to do this on your own as a sole means of weight loss that it fails, we all start to cheat and then gain any loses back. When we have the WLS in our sites it makes it easier to stick to and you can reap the benefits of some weight loss, smaller liver and cleaner bowels post-op.
